Commit eb72dc663e9070b281be83a80f6f838a3a878822 introduces a ICE on AArch64.
Compiling this with -S -fgnu-tm -O0:
typedef int __attribute__ ((vector_size (16))) vectype;
vectype v;
void
foo (int c)
{
vectype *p = __builtin_malloc (sizeof (vectype));
__transaction_atomic
{
*p = v;
if (c)
__transaction_cancel;
}
}
gives:
testcase.c: In function ‘foo’:
testcase.c:5:1: error: virtual definition of statement not up to date
5 | foo (int c)
| ^~~
D.3669 = v.0_11;
during GIMPLE pass: tmmark
testcase.c:5:1: internal compiler error: verify_ssa failed
on the tmmark output is:
....
<L0>:
__builtin__ITM_memcpyRtWn (&D.3667, &v, 16);
v.0_11 = D.3667;
D.3668 = v.0_11;
__builtin__ITM_memcpyRnWt (p_4, &D.3668, 16);
...
the following fixes the latent bug - we failed to mark 'D.3668'
TREE_ADDRESSABLE (address-taken)
diff --git a/gcc/trans-mem.c b/gcc/trans-mem.c
index c23ecd2b31f..b6b9157006b 100644
--- a/gcc/trans-mem.c
+++ b/gcc/trans-mem.c
@@ -2424,6 +2424,7 @@ expand_assign_tm (struct tm_region *region,
gimple_stmt_iterator *gsi)
if (is_gimple_reg (rhs))
{
tree rtmp = create_tmp_var (TREE_TYPE (rhs));
+ TREE_ADDRESSABLE (rtmp) = 1;
rhs_addr = build_fold_addr_expr (rtmp);
gcall = gimple_build_assign (rtmp, rhs);
gsi_insert_before (gsi, gcall, GSI_SAME_STMT);
